Synopsis for the April 9 episode, ‘The Michael Scott Paper Company’:

MICHAEL HOSTS A COMPANY LUNCHEON—IDRIS ELBA (“The Wire”) GUEST STARS—Dwight (Rainn Wilson) and Andy (Ed Helms) strike up an unlikely friendship and plan a hunting trip. Regional Supervisor Charles (Idris Elba) asks Jim (John Krasinski) for a “rundown”, and Jim spends his day trying to figure out what that is. Michael (Steve Carell) hosts a Paper & Pancakes luncheon. Jenna Fischer, B.J. Novak, Leslie David Baker, Brian Baumgartner, Kate Flannery, Mindy Kaling, Angela Kinsey, Phyllis Smith, Oscar Nunez, Creed Bratton and Paul Lieberstein also star.

Synopsis for the April 9 episode, ‘Dream Team’:

MICHAEL ASSEMBLES HIS DREAM TEAM—IDRIS ELBA (“The Wire”) GUEST STARS—After getting off on the wrong foot with his new supervisor, Charles (Idris Elba), Jim (John Krasinski) finds himself face to face with the new boss in a soccer game in the Dunder Mifflin parking lot. Meanwhile, Michael (Steve Carell), afraid to face the workday, has trouble leaving his house. Rainn Wilson, Jenna Fischer, B.J. Novak, Ed Helms, Leslie David Baker, Brian Baumgartner, Kate Flannery, Mindy Kaling, Angela Kinsey, Phyllis Smith, Oscar Nunez, Creed Bratton and Paul Lieberstein also star.

The second episode to air on April 9 is entitled ‘The Michael Scott Paper Company.’ No synopsis yet.

Mar. 17: E! Online

The U.K.’s Daily Record reported on Friday that Ricky Gervais is heading to the U.S. to make a cameo on the last episode of The Office as David Brent, the boss of the BBC version of our favorite comedy.

Well, we got the real deal from executive producer Paul Lieberstein (Toby!).

“We love Ricky, but have not had any discussions about an appearance on the U.S. show,” says Paul. “And we haven’t given any thought to the final show because it is probably a zillion episodes away.”

The only guests scheduled for now are the previously announced Idris Elba (The Wire, Rocknrolla), who comes back this week, and Amy Ryan (The Wire, Gone Baby Gone), who will return as H.R. goddess Holly Flax by the final episode of the season.

Mar. 2: NBC UNIVERSAL MEDIA VILLAGE

Synopsis for ‘Two Weeks’ (March 26th):

MICHAEL TAKES GOOFING OFF TO A NEW LEVEL – IDRIS ELBA (“The Wire”) GUEST STARS — Michael’s (Golden Globe winner Steve Carell) relationship with the new vice president (guest star Idris Elba) becomes increasingly tense, as Michael finds an excuse to goof off even more than usual. Meanwhile, Pam (Jenna Fischer) faces the challenge of a new copier and Kelly (Mindy Kaling) develops a crush. Rainn Wilson, John Krasinski, Ed Helms, Leslie David Baker, Brian Baumgartner, Kate Flannery, Angela Kinsey, Phyllis Smith, Oscar Nunez, Craig Robinson, Creed Bratton and Paul Lieberstein also star.
